1

私は最近の不運なイベントがあります。私はビジネスパートナーのSQLServer 2005サーバーをホストしており、 "sa"パスワードは不思議に変わっています(誰も責任を負いたくありません)。だから私は、は、すべてのパスワードの変更を記録するSQL Server 2005を構成する方法はありますか?SQL Serverのパスワードの変更をログ

私は、Windows Server 2003、Windows Server 2008などで実現できることを知っています。しかし、問題は、Windows XP Proで実行していることです(私はこれをやってはいけないと知っていますが、私のビジネスパートナーは彼女にフル・フェッジWindows Server OSを購入する予算はないと主張しています)。

ありがとうございます!

答えて

0

2回目のデータを失ったら、データベースを一から作成するのに十分なお金がありますか?真剣に言えば、最後のアクセスを見るためにWindowsのイベントビューアを使うだけです。 SAは通常、セキュリティログにイベントを表示します。

0

gbnは正しいアイデアを持っていた。

私はAaron Bertrandが書いた素晴らしい例を見つけた。
は基本的にあなたがスタックオーバーフローに推奨されたリンクに答えるここ
http://www.mssqltips.com/sqlservertip/2708/tracking-login-password-changes-in-sql-server/

+0

彼の例を見つけることができますAUDIT_LOGIN_CHANGE_PASSWORD_EVENTパラメータ

CREATE EVENT NOTIFICATION PasswordChangeNotification ON SERVER WITH FAN_IN FOR AUDIT_LOGIN_CHANGE_PASSWORD_EVENT TO SERVICE 'PasswordChangeService', 'current database'; GO 

でイベントを作成する必要があります。あなたの答えのOPの質問に答えるそのページの部分を提供して、将来の読者がリンクが壊れてもそれを読むことができるようにします。 –

+0

それは完全な答えを与えるためにそのウェブサイトからの大きい塊を必要とします...そしてそれは私のために盗むように感じるでしょう...とにかくあなたはarchive.orgでバックアップを見つけることができます、逃してしまった... – fuchs777

+0

標準的な習慣として、元のスレッドの重要な部分を含めることができます。今の場合、ソリューションを正確に実装するアイデアを含めることができ、さらに参照するために下部にリンクを含めることができます。 –

関連する問題